Launching a New Era for British Basketball

British basketball is stepping into a brand-new era with the launch of the British Championship Basketball (BCB) league. Built from the foundations of the former NBL Division One, BCB brings together clubs, players, and fans with a shared vision: to grow the game we all love and make it stronger across the UK.


The league has been formed in partnership with the British Basketball Federation and the Home Country Associations in England, Scotland, and Wales. By working together, the aim is simple: to create clear pathways for players, coaches, and officials while making sure the sport is inclusive and accessible to every community.

This first season will see a fantastic line-up of clubs representing their cities and communities:

  • City of Birmingham Rockets

  • Bristol Hurricanes

  • Bristol Flyers

  • Essex Rebels

  • Derby Trailblazers

  • Hemel Storm

  • London Cavaliers

  • Loughborough Riders

  • MK Breakers

  • Newcastle Knights

  • Nottingham Hoods

  • Reading Rockets

  • Worthing Thunder

  • Yorkshire Dragons


Every one of these clubs brings its own history, fans, and passion to the court. Together, they form the backbone of a league that is focused on collaboration, development, and sustainability.
